The product of two consecutive positive integers is 26 more than ten times the largest of the two numbers.

1. Write an equation to represent the situation above.

Answer:

x(x+1)=10(x+1)+26

Explanation:

Let the two consecutive positive integers be x and x+1.

The product of these two integers is x(x+1).

The largest of the two numbers is x+1.

By given, x(x+1)=10(x+1)+26.
